WebApr 6, 2024 · Indiana courts use the "best interests of the child" standard to make child custody decisions. Specifically, judges refer to Indiana Code Section 31-17-2-8 which says: The court shall determine custody and enter a custody order in accordance with the best interests of the child. WebJan 6, 2024 · Indiana’s custody laws make no assumptions about which parent is the best parent based on gender. Laws do not favor either parent when determining physical custody and what is in the best interest of the child. Both parents start out on equal footing with the court. WebIn Indiana, modification of child custody agreements are governed under § 31-17-2-21. Understand, there are two specific aspects of child custody: physical and legal. Physical custody refers to where the children are spending their time, with which parent they are staying on a particular day. It is also referred to as “parenting time.”.
